Typically this time of year sees couples across the world tying the knot. Due to the coronavirus pandemic, many weddings this year have been canceled, but don’t worry, Animal Crossing: New Horizons is trying to fill the void.

For the month of June, players can follow the anniversary celebration for fan-favorite characters, Cyrus and Reese. Players will be able to partake in a photo challenge over the course of the month featuring the two characters.

To start, players will have to go to Harv’s island which you will find Cyrus and Reese trying to recreate their wedding day. Your first task will be to help the two reimagine their wedding. Upon completing the recreation, if you do a good job, Reese will give you some Heart Crystals which can be traded for other items from Cyrus.

Obviously, with the month just starting, there are a lot more details that have yet to be discovered, but it should be an exciting month for players.
